Types of Modern Windows
Modern window installation can be categorized into numerous types, each serving a special function. Here is a list of the most common kinds of windows you may consider:

Casement Windows: Hinged at the side, casement windows open external, enabling for optimum ventilation. They are perfect for hard-to-reach locations and often offer much better energy efficiency compared to other designs.

Sliding Windows: As the name recommends, these windows move open horizontally. They provide a sleek design and are especially suitable for larger openings.

Picture Windows: Fixed windows that do not open, image windows enable for unblocked views and are typically utilized in mix with other window types.

Bay and Bow Windows: These protrude from the home, offering additional interior area and a breathtaking view. They can include considerable curb interest any home.

Selecting the right type of window depends upon various factors including area, performance, and the overall visual of the home.

Setting up modern windows comes with a wide variety of benefits. Here are some key advantages:

Energy Efficiency: Modern windows are created with innovative functions that can substantially minimize energy bills. Double Glazing Experts or triple Experienced Double Glazing, low-E finishings, and inert gas fillings play a role in maintaining indoor temperatures.

Enhanced Aesthetics: New windows can drastically change the look and mood of your home. With various designs and finishes, property owners have endless choices to pick from.

Increased Home Value: Upgrading to modern windows can improve the resale value of a home. Potential purchasers are often willing to pay more for homes with energy-efficient features.

Noise Reduction: Modern windows frequently decrease noise invasion from outside, enhancing the general convenience of the home.

Improved Safety and Security: Advanced locking mechanisms and tempered glass choices make contemporary windows safer.
Elements to Consider When Installing Windows
Before proceeding with window installation, property owners need to consider numerous factors:

Budget: Determine how much you want to invest in Residential Window Replacement installation and focus on the functions that matter many.

Designs and Aesthetics: Choose window styles that complement the style of your home while resolving your particular needs.

Environment: Considering local environment conditions can inform your option of products and types of windows.

Installation Time: Some types of windows require longer installation durations. Evaluate how this may affect your daily routine.

Regulative Compliance: Check local building codes, as there might be guidelines regarding window installation.
